FIA to review formation lap radio communication rules

The FIA is open to reviewing the restrictions on radio communication between teams and drivers on a race's formation lap after Haas was caught in breach of the rules in Hungary. At the Hungaroring, both Kevin Magnussen and Romain Grosjean were asked by their team to pit at the end of the formation lap in order to swap their wet tyres for a set of slicks. The bold strategy that paid handsome dividends for Magnussen, but the Dane and Grosjean were both handed a post-race 10-second time penalty for breaching radio chat rules.
